Chess Puzzle #21yhO — Beginner, Black to move, middlegame

Rating 678 · Beginner · endgame, mate, mate in 2, short.

Position

White: king g1; rook e6; knights a6/f3; pawns a4/c2/d5/f2/g2/g3. Black: king f7; rook b2; knight g4; pawns d6/g5/h6. White is ahead by 6 points of material. Black to move.

Solution (2 moves)

  1. Opponent setup: Nd4 — knight f3→d4. Now Black to move.
  2. Best move: Rb1+ — rook b2→b1, gives check. Opponent replies Re1 (rook e6→e1).
  3. Best move: Rxe1# — rook b1→e1, captures rook, delivers checkmate.

Tactical themes

endgame, mate, mate in 2, short. The combination ends with Rxe1# delivering checkmate.
